Key Responsibilities

  • •Own XDR strategy and delivery across cross-domain detection and response (endpoint, cloud, identity, network).
  • •Lead the XDR expansion into exposure and vulnerability management, including patch management and remediation workflows.
  • •Bring adjacent signals (attack surface and cloud posture) into exposure prioritization rather than building separate products.
  • •Partner with Entity Analytics and Security Labs to ground detection and exposure scoring in asset criticality and threat research.
  • •Serve as the product voice with senior customer stakeholders and create roadmap trackers, decision memos, and competitive briefs to guide direction.

Key Requirements

  • •7–10 years of product management experience, including at least 4 years in security or B2B enterprise software.
  • •A track record of owning a product area with meaningful revenue impact and leading products from strategy through shipped outcomes.
  • •Hands-on domain knowledge of XDR/EDR/SIEM or security operations, including correlation, response automation, and detection engineering.
  • •Fluency in exposure and vulnerability prioritization, including why exploitability and reachability matter.
  • •Strong analytics and threat understanding for detection and prioritization; AI security familiarity is a plus.

Company Brief

Elastic
Builds the Elastic Stack (Elasticsearch, Kibana, Beats, Logstash) and provides search, observability, and security solutions that enable organizations to search, analyze, and protect data in real time across applications, infrastructure, and enterprises.
